Evaluación de un Sistema de Inmersión Temporal frente al método de propagación convencional en la multiplicación in vitro de cilantro cimarrón (Eryngium foetidum) a partir de …


Abstract:

In this investigation, Eryngium foetidum (spirit weed) was used as a model plant in order to develop future projects about micropropagation of other productive an economically interesting species through temporary immersion systems (TIS). Besides, E. foetidum has some potential characteristics which could be used on future investigations on metabolite production for pharmacological and industrial purposes. At the establishment stage of micropropagation of spirit weed, leaves, petioles, and axilar buds were used by applying different concentrations of NaClO. The most viable resulted to be axilar buds which were surface sterilized using a commercial detergent and disinfected on 0.8%(v/v) of NaClO for 10 minutes.
